BaNiMo₂ is an intermetallic compound combining barium, nickel, and molybdenum elements, representing a research-phase material rather than a widely commercialized alloy. This material family is of interest in fundamental materials science for exploring high-temperature phases and potentially novel functional properties, though applications remain largely experimental. Engineers would consider this material primarily in specialized research contexts or emerging applications where the unique combination of these elements offers advantages not found in conventional engineering alloys.
